Ukraine's begins producing, testing new ammunition – Turchynov

New ammunition production lines have started work by decision of Ukraine's National Security and Defense Council (NSDC), the NSDC press service has said, citing its secretary Oleksandr Turchynov.

According to him, test of the new ammunition and weapons produced in Ukraine were carried out at the Honcharivske firing range of the Ukrainian Armed Forces.

"An important phase of testing the most scarce 152mm shells and 60mm mines for new Ukrainian mortars took place," Turchynov said.

He added that two modifications of 60mm and two modifications of 82mm mortars were also tested, as well as 120mm mortars.

In addition, the NSDC secretary said that during the tests all ballistic characteristics were checked by "a modern unique complex - a mobile radar system for trajectory measurements."

Turchynov said the tested ammunition and artillery weapons "are produced by both public and private enterprises, which makes it possible to improve their quality within the limits of transparent competition and, consequently, to reduce cost."

"I want to emphasize that all the tests were successful, Ukrainian weapons and ammunition showed compliance with specified characteristics and will soon be used by Ukraine's Armed Forces," Turchynov said.
